Types of Copy Paper
When it pertains to copy paper, one size does not fit all. Here's a breakdown of the most common kinds of copy paper offered in the market.
TypeDescriptionNormal Use CasesStandard Copy PaperGenerally 20 pound, 92 brightness; suitable for everyday printing and copying.General workplace use, documents, memos.High-Quality PaperHeavier weight (24 pound+) with higher brightness (up to 100); smoother surface.Presentations, reports, resumes.Recycled PaperMade from post-consumer waste; available in numerous weights and brightness.Eco-friendly choice.Colored PaperReadily available in numerous colors; utilized for categorizing files or developing leaflets.Flyers, innovative jobs, archival.Specialized PaperConsists of pre-printed types, shiny paper, and cardstock.Marketing products, certificates.Key Specifications to Consider
When acquiring copy paper, watch on the following specs:
Weight: Measured in pounds (pound), the weight affects the thickness and toughness of the paper. Brightness: This determines how well the paper reflects light; greater brightness causes better contrast and image quality.Finish: Glossy, matte, and semi-gloss surfaces serve various functions and can impact printing quality.Size: Standard sizes consist of Letter (8.5" x 11"), Legal (8.5" x 14"), and A4 Printing Paper (8.27" x 11.69"). What is the best weight for copy paper?
Answer: For the majority of everyday printing requirements, 20 pound paper suffices. Nevertheless, if you are printing presentations or documents you wish to stand apart, 24 lb paper is advised.
2. Can I use recycled paper for color printing?
Answer: Yes, recycled paper can be used for color printing. Just make sure that it's appropriate for your printer type, as some recycled documents might have a different texture that can affect print quality.
3. How do I know which brightness level to select?
Response: A brightness level of 92 is appropriate for most office jobs. If you require sharper text or vivid colors in your prints, you may select paper with a brightness of 100 or greater.
4. Exists a benefit in utilizing colored copy paper?
Response: Colored paper can help in organizing documents efficiently. It likewise includes a visual appeal to brochures or advertising materials.
5. Can I use copy paper for my inkjet printer?
Answer: Yes, both inkjet and laser printers can utilize standard Cheap Copy Paper paper. Nevertheless, inspect the paper's compatibility with your particular printer to avoid any feeding issues.
